
Machine Operator — A machine operator is responsible for operating and maintaining machinery. Works in a dedicated capacity specializing in a single machine or class of machines (e.g., Drill and Punch Press, Injection Molding Machine). Job duties and conditions vary depending on industry and job function. May adjust machine as needed for changeovers, different functions, or other varying needs of production.
The Machine Operator may:
- Operate specialty machinery to fabricate, manufacture, assemble or move products
- Maintain and monitor machines to make sure they function properly
- Understanding of how operated machine works
- Conduct quality checks periodically
- Verify adequate materials and supplies are available to complete operations as needed
- Analyze machine operations and output if applicable
